Output 39dd3edb9daa8685f31c20596d2bdd27a5a018efe3a2c5c5b8673b7691217a5f:1

value
30622220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dbc0484dbf365b6a1e8983244a7757b6dd1038 OP_EQUAL
address
MHTbkxLUjfAkJSExB9DgBFAfC4UHMR6TZz
transaction
39dd3edb9daa8685f31c20596d2bdd27a5a018efe3a2c5c5b8673b7691217a5f
spent
true